Vintage Madeline Weinrib Geometric Cotton Rug in White and Grey

About the Item

20th century, India, a flat weave cotton rug from the "Amagansett" collection, with a geometric white floral design on a grey ground, label to underside. This Madeline Weinrib rug was hand-woven in India. These 100% cotton flat weave rugs are coveted for their graphic impact and easy, effortless chic. This carpet would be the the perfect addition to any room. The rug is reversible. Madeline Weinrib started her eponymous company in 1997 with a beautifully graphic collection of Indian flat weave cotton carpets, ED contributing editor Weinrib seduced the fashion, art, and design worlds with bold, unabashedly painterly textiles. An artist first, she crafted a business out of her contemporary take on traditional Asian and Middle Eastern fabrics, rendered in high quality, handmade creations that also helped support local weaving and artisanal industries in the countries she visited. In 2018 she shocked the design world by announcing the closing of her business. As a result, Madeline Weinrib rugs are becoming increasingly scarce and sought after. Dimensions: 12'L x 9'W Condition: Good, clean with little wear, even colors Provenance: A Private Collection: Amagansett, NY.

Provenance: Property from the Collection of a Media Executive History of Kashmir carpets and rugs: With an illustrious history dating back to the 14th century, Kashmir carpets are renowned for their jewel like luminous color tones, exemplary craftsmanship and fine quality. It was by the way of Mir Sayyid Ali Hamadani, a Sufi saint from the Persian city of Hamadan that the textile weaving in Kashmir grew and developed between 1379 and 1383.
